Zoom Apps enable 3rd party developers to create and distribute apps that enrich the Zoom experience, and enhance the meeting workflow to increase productivity before, during and after a meeting. First Zoom Apps ship this year, open to developers thereafter.
Zoom Apps Preview launched on Product Hunt on October 14th, 2020 and earned 623 upvotes and 103 comments, earning #1 Product of the Day. A “hunter” on Product Hunt is the community member who submits a product to the platform — uploading the images, the link, and tagging the makers behind it. Hunters typically write the first comment explaining why a product is worth attention, and their followers are notified the moment they post. Around 79% of featured launches on Product Hunt are self-hunted by their makers, but a well-known hunter still acts as a signal of quality to the rest of the community.
